Job Summary
This role supports the MR usability team to ensure Philips products are safe, effective, and intuitive for patients and users.
You will co-develop usability strategies and conduct user research while collaborating with a global multidisciplinary team including engineers and clinical specialists.
The position requires supporting the lead usability engineer in creating compliance files that meet FDA, NMPA, and IEC62366-1 regulations.
